We don't trust the Jerries... Bill is reading our thread. ;)

I've got three T-34s by the middle village along with almost a company of infantry. I'm in control of the VLs but Bill has a couple of companies (at least) of those damn Finn smg guys on his side of the town in the woods. He's starting to move two Stugs up towards my village to support his assault (no attack yet, but infantry on the little hill to the left). I've got a 75mm at gun with los, but I'm letting him come closer before opening up. Also, I'm swinging two other T-34s back behind the center town to take on the Stugs. I doubt I'll even attack his town. I see a two sound contacts on guns in his town and I'm sure he has a bunch of mgs in there too. If he tries to overrun my guys in the middle, my T-34s should be able to mow him down. With that Battalion of Sissis (that's got to be what they bought), he's got some at rifles too, so I'm keeping my T-34s buttoned.

My game with Bill is moving along. He destroyed one of the Heavy VL buildings in the middle with an infantry gun (I only have a sound spotting on it). I've seen Steve's movies and he can see at least 4 infantry guns. An interesting pick by the Jerries -- pretty smart actually -- thay are good at disabling T-34s. Luckily, I moved all six squads I had in the building back to the light two story building behind the heavy one well before Bill destroyed it. I'm moving back into the rubble next turn. He has los on the other VL building, so I'm moving them out next turn as well. He has a ton of infantry in the woods on his side, but I have three T-34s in the middle that have them pinned. If he tries to rush, he'll get smacked. But I don't think he will. We have 10 or so turns left and it appears he's going to keep his Stugs back and not assault my village either. I should get a minor victory if things stay the same. I wish he'd bring his Stugs up. I have three T-34s in the middle and two waiting on my left for the Stugs. On the right, I have a company and a platoon of infantry and one T-34, I can't see any guns with the 4 at rifles I have on the hill close to his town. My T-34 is blowing up the two story buildings, but I don't plan on making an assault -- I think it would be futile, and I own the middle two large VLs, so I'm hoping Bill will feel the need to be aggressive, but he's too smart for that and will probably try to get a draw or a narrow defeat.

On the other hand, Steve is putting the hurt on AirborneBob. Steve has the middle and has crushed Bob's infantry in the middle and near Steve's town. Bob tried an assault and has taken heavy casualties. Bob has also moved up his Stugs (three Stug IIIFs) and Steve is hitting them with at rifle fire and flanking them with a T-34. Like me, Steve has three T-34s in the middle town and the others in flanking position on the left. Bob has opened up with at least 4 infantry guns and Steve has killed at least one. I doubt Steve will assault Bob's town, but he should end up with a major victory -- if the fates are with him on his Stug hunt. The wiley old veteran Bill is keeping his Stugs back where they are most effective. Bob has his too close and will pay.

So it seems the Germans went with a Finn Sissi Battalion, a platoon of Stug IIIfs, at least 4 infantry guns (76mm) and probably another company or so of infantry for defense. The Sissi Battalions have about 8 maxims and 8 at rifles and bunch of smg squads and a 81 mm spotter. I haven't seen any German infantry, but they may have a company or so in their village on defense. Our T-34s are dominant in the middle vl (I'm keeping mine buttoned in case he gets los with an at rifle).
